> > Hi,
> >  I have a small issue. I am using the lp command for printing on a remote server.
> >
> >  lp -d MyPrinter -h 100.102.200.138:631 MyTextFile.txt
> >
> > In the lp command, i do not want to pass the exact file to be printed. Rather i want to just send a reference of a file which is present on the remote server. How can i achieve this. Please help
